Program Summary: It’s difficult for the public (i.e. jurors) to understand how and why false confessions occur. This program is designed to help criminal defense lawyers understand the science behind false confessions, and how to persuasively argue against the validity of these confessions in court. You will learn about coercive police interrogation techniques (Reid technique), and how these real-world police tactics can easily induce a false confession. A taxonomy of false confessions will also be presented, as well as empirical findings demonstrating the impact of police interrogation techniques on eliciting false confessions. Lastly, you will learn about the additional considerations that affect defending mentally ill and developmentally disabled clients, and how to better represent these vulnerable populations in court.
